Read moreBiden Proposes Cap on Rental Increases Nationwide
By Brad Beckett on July 18, 2024
Various news outlets are reporting that President Joe Biden is proposing a 5% cap on rental increases, in effect implementing de-facto rent control, nationwide. Biden’s plan will cap rent increases to 5% annually for landlords with more than 50 units but, it will reportedly face stiff opposition in Congress. Click here to read more.
